Sizing & selection

Selecting the correct endodontic file helps ensure safe canal instrumentation and effective treatment.

File size:

Endodontic files are numbered according to tip diameter. The #08 Kerr Dental SybronEndo K File is designed for negotiating narrow canals and establishing initial canal pathways.

File length:

Different tooth anatomies require different instrument lengths. The 25 mm length of SybronEndo Hedstrom files is commonly used for many endodontic cases.

Manual instrumentation:

Manual hand files allow clinicians to feel canal anatomy more precisely. SybronEndo Hedstrom files are often used early in treatment to establish canal patency before rotary files are introduced.

Care & storage

Proper handling helps maintain the performance and safety of SybronEndo Hedstrom Files.

  • Store SybronEndo Hedstrom Files in a clean, dry environment
  • Keep files organized in sterilization cassettes or endodontic trays
  • Inspect files before each use for distortion or damage
  • Sterilize files according to clinical instrument protocols
  • Dispose of worn or damaged files according to sharps or instrument disposal guidelines
